Low Resistance Conductive Cloth Adhesive Tape: Advanced EMI Shielding Solution

Low Resistance Conductive Cloth Adhesive Tape is an advanced functional material specifically engineered for electronic applications requiring reliable electromagnetic interference (EMI) shielding and static charge dissipation. This specialized tape consists of a flexible fabric substrate typically made from polyester fibers that undergo multiple metallization processes, resulting in exceptional electrical conductivity and environmental resistance.

The tape features a durable construction with multiple layered coatings - beginning with nickel deposition, followed by high-conductivity copper, and finished with an anti-oxidation nickel layer for surface protection . This sophisticated combination delivers both performance reliability and long-term durability in demanding applications.

Key Technical Specifications

  • Surface Resistance: <0.05Ω/square (typical) 

  • Shielding Effectiveness: >62dB across frequency spectrum 100K-3GHz 

  • Total Thickness: 0.12mm ± 0.01mm 

  • Adhesion Strength: 0.9-1.1 kg/25mm peel strength 

  • Temperature Resistance: -20°C to +80°C (standard); special variants up to +150°C 

  • Abrasion Resistance: Withstands up to 5,000,000 friction cycles (ASTM D4966) 

  • Halogen Content: Free of halogens per IEC-61249-2-21 standard 

Performance Advantages

Superior Conductivity

The multilayer metal coating system provides exceptional electrical performance with low surface resistance, ensuring reliable grounding and current carrying capacity. The nickel-copper-nickel structure creates a continuous conductive path that maintains stability even under dynamic flexing conditions .

Enhanced Durability

Unlike conventional conductive materials, this tape offers outstanding mechanical properties including high tensile strength (80N/cm) and excellent abrasion resistance . The robust construction withstands physical stress during installation and throughout product lifecycle.

Reliable EMI Shielding

The conductive fabric structure creates an effective Faraday cage enclosure, blocking electromagnetic interference across a broad frequency range from 100kHz to 3GHz . This protection is crucial for sensitive electronic equipment in today's connected environments.

Environmental Resistance

Special anti-oxidation treatment provides corrosion protection, while the temperature-resistant adhesive maintains performance across various climatic conditions encountered in Southeast Asian markets .

Application Guidelines

Surface Preparation

For optimal performance, ensure bonding surfaces are clean and dry before application. Use isopropyl alcohol or similar solvents to remove contaminants, followed by complete drying .

Installation Conditions

Apply tape within the recommended temperature range of +21°C to +38°C for proper adhesive bonding. Avoid application below +10°C as the adhesive becomes too firm for immediate adhesion .

Pressure Application

Use firm, consistent pressure during installation to develop complete adhesive contact with the substrate. This ensures maximum bond strength and conductivity .

Industry Applications

Electronics Manufacturing

  • Circuit Board Shielding: Isolate sensitive components from electromagnetic interference

  • Cable Management: Secure and shield flat flexible cables (FFC) in compact devices

  • Grounding Solutions: Create reliable electrical paths between components and chassis

Telecommunications Equipment

  • 5G Infrastructure: Shield base station components from signal interference 

  • Network Hardware: Protect server and switching equipment in data centers

Consumer Electronics

  • Mobile Devices: Internal EMI shielding in smartphones and tablets

  • Display Systems: LCD and plasma television interference protection 

  • Computer Systems: Laptop and desktop internal grounding applications 

Automotive Electronics

  • Electric Vehicles: Battery management systems and control modules 

  • In-Vehicle Infotainment: Shield sensitive entertainment and navigation systems

Medical Equipment

  • Diagnostic Devices: Protect sensitive instrumentation from external interference 

  • Patient Monitoring: Ensure reliable operation of critical care equipment

Material Composition & Structure

  1. Base Layer: Polyester fiber fabric substrate for flexibility and strength

  2. Primary Conductive Layer: Electrodeposited copper for high conductivity

  3. Surface Layer: Nickel coating for oxidation prevention and corrosion resistance

  4. Adhesive System: Pressure-sensitive conductive acrylic adhesive containing nickel particles 

Storage & Handling Recommendations

  • Maintain in dry environment at approximately 20°C with 65% relative humidity 

  • Shelf life approximately 6 months from manufacturing date 

  • Allow tape to acclimate to room temperature (approximately 20°C) for 3+ hours before use in low-humidity conditions
